Community Shops
If your community has lost its shop, or your village shop is
threatened with closure, the Essex Village Shops Handbook will be able to
help. It tells you everything you need to know about how to set up and
run a community owned shop. There is also a lot of useful
information on the Plunkett
Foundation website where you can join the Community Shop Network,
and on the Big
Lottery Village SOS website.

Community Pubs
Many communities in Essex are thinking about taking over the
local pub and running it themselves as the only way to keep in open.
There is a lot of information on the Big Lottery Village SOS
website , the Pub
is the Hub website, and Plunkett Co-operative Pubs Online.
